Output 57183d3b79fe8efa87740d5eeafb12476d2bc8b841f17df5f1a66ad4a494dcf8:0

value
85380764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76bc4fe4365817f9eceb431aa926efe0e9f91acf OP_EQUAL
address
3CWqFLDeppi5S2Unbh9fgKwzMkMFrCNgMD
transaction
57183d3b79fe8efa87740d5eeafb12476d2bc8b841f17df5f1a66ad4a494dcf8
confirmations
537886
spent
true